In a significant philanthropic gesture, Khalaf Ahmad Al Habtoor, the Founder and Chairman of Al Habtoor Group, has donated five residential units from the esteemed Al Habtoor City development to the Real Estate Developers’ Endowment. This initiative, established in collaboration with the Dubai Land Department (DLD) and overseen by the Mohammed bin Rashid Global Centre for Endowment Consultancy (MBRGCEC), is designed to enhance enduring charitable initiatives across the UAE.
The Al Habtoor Group will manage these donated units, with annual proceeds allocated to social and humanitarian programs. The funds raised will directly support sectors such as healthcare, education, and assistance for underserved populations, including orphans, widows, and individuals with disabilities.
Al Habtoor underscored the significance of endowments as a permanent vehicle for social responsibility. “This nation thrives on a spirit of generosity. These initiatives are meant to uplift the community and demonstrate our dedication to the values of the UAE,” he remarked.
